Maximum coverage Wireless Sensor Network (WSN) with lower energy consumption may not be achieved without a proper sensor node placement. This paper uses a biologically inspired optimization technique known as Territorial Predator Scent Marking Algorithm (TPSMA) with maximum coverage ratio objective function to arrange the sensor nodes in WSN. It is desirable to position sensor nodes in a Wireless Sensor Network (WSN) to be able to provide maximum coverage with minimum energy consumption. However, these two aspects are contradicting and quite impossible to solve the placement problem with a single optimal decision.
